Core Values
Rural Atmosphere: Concern for Environment
- Preserving the rural atmosphere and protecting the environment are essential to safeguarding the appearance and character of Homer Glen.
- Homer Glen's rural atmosphere is characterized by open space, agricultural settings, and the presence of large lots with horses and other domestic farm animals.
- Protecting the environment is important to the health and well being of Homer Glen citizens.
- Safeguarding areas of significant natural value, promoting the re-establishment of native vegetation, protecting and managing water resources, and providing wildlife corridors are fundamental environmental protections.
- Understanding the agricultural roots and historical background of our geographic area will enrich the community and further clarify the need for preserving our rural atmosphere.
Managed Growth Density: Commercial Base Development
- Responsible residential and commercial development protects quality of life by limiting adverse effects such as school overcrowding, flooding, road congestion, poor water quality and other environmental problems.
- The highest priority in land-use decisions should be to protect residents from adverse impacts of differing land use patterns.
- The Village of Homer Glen and its citizens benefit from commercial development that is consistent with the Village's Comprehensive Plan.
Inclusion - A Sense of Community: Limit Intrusive Government
- Involvement of residents ensures an effective, representative, responsive government.
- Promoting and encouraging the participation of all community members ensures the concerns of all are represented and respected.
- Homer Glen residents benefit from a safe, family-oriented community by maintaining and enhancing educational, recreational and cultural opportunities. Pursuing alternative methods for funding these objectives without burdening taxpayers is a priority.
- Homer Glen officials are entrusted to provide balance and stability while operating the Village in the least restrictive manner feasible.
- A fiscally accountable government is needed to protect the interests of Homer Glen taxpayers.
